Dirk i'm a huge dude(6'2 and 170kg) and maybe i absorb recoil better, but i definately get back on target a bit faster with the 165gr bullts. I Shot about 450 rounds of 180gr S&B factory loads through my G22 before i reloaded the 165gr'ers. I prefer the 165's for range work. I bought the 180gr before i had the reloading dies etc to reload myslef. Now i at least have brand new once fired brass available for reloading.
Try reloading 50 of each weigt and run them through your Glock, and see what feels BEST for you.
